Fixed the broken tabs on my headlight... Man I hated that shaky headlight at night! So nice now!

Years ago I got a set of crystal clear headlights from my dads salvage yard,(contour with 60,000 miles) the down side, all the tabs where broken!! my friend that owned a shop and was able to get them glued the broken tabs together, been good ever since.
 
Every now and then I can find a set of semi-decent headlights at a junkyard. After polishing them up, I have been using JB Weld to coat the cracked, but intact tabs. So far, after 10000+ miles, the reinforced tabs are still holding up.
